About Me

Stephen Oduro is a kind man married with a child. I am very blessed and completed my second cycle institution at Agogo State in Agogo. I was raised from a broken home so life was a bit tough for me but I manage to get through all of that. My girl child wants to become a banker and I want to work hard to make her dream comes true. I am truly happy to be part of this community of Zidisha.

My Business

I sell all kinds of Ghana made foot wears to bankers, schools, and other people. I make on both retail and wholesale which generate income and profit on daily basis. My demands decipline and more attention and if supported i would make enough profit and I have three apprentices that I work with.

Loan Proposal

The loan I am applying for is going to be used to buy leaders to make shoes and sandals to serve my customers. Since schools are reopening next week the market would be good for me as I would be able to sell more sandals and shoes. This would help raise profit and I use the profit for expenses and reinvestment.

Income Source

I would be paying this loan from the profit I gain from selling out sandals and shoes to my clients who purchase them. Thank you
